Output 6bd74aa13146cdc53ffd5be266c5684451feba100003a93d0d615fc138ca31b6:0

value
3802285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25bdeaf676c0a516515539b5759b771d121d18aa OP_EQUAL
address
358aSN1yPA8ykufcysLi6QaK4g2W2CheBF
transaction
6bd74aa13146cdc53ffd5be266c5684451feba100003a93d0d615fc138ca31b6
spent
true